Budak Lapok

Budak Lapok is a 2007 animated film in Malaysia. This film is based on the P. Ramlee film Bujang Lapok. The film premiered on 13 October 2007.

Biography

Datuk Abdul Aziz bin Sattar (Jawi: عبدالعزيز بن ستار;‎ 8 August 1925 – 6 May 2014) or well known as Aziz Sattar was a Malaysian actor, singer, comedian, and director who is well known for his roles in the golden age of black and white Malay films of the 1950s and 1960s in Singapore.
